Subject: Export memory fix shipped

Team — the Ledgerfox spreadsheet export no longer buffers entire workbooks in memory. Rows now stream in 4k chunks, cutting peak usage by roughly 80% on large tenants. If exports regress, check the streaming flag in the Harrow config before anything else. Rolled out to all regions this morning. The associated build token follows.

trace token, fafog-kageg: htk4_98e6

## Service Accounts — PayFlux Integration Tests

Quick note for the sync: the flaky tests in the PayFlux settlement suite are mostly down to the shared `svc-payflux-ci` account hitting rate limits when two pipelines run at once. Marta split the account per environment last week, which helped, but staging still fails about one run in five. Until the permanent fix lands, reruns are fine. If you need to run the suite locally, authenticate with the key below.

app token of badug-tahaf = qvz11-nP5FBNr8qnh

Q: How does Brindle retry failed webhook deliveries?

A: Five attempts with exponential backoff, starting at 30 seconds, capping at one hour. A 2xx stops retries; 410 disables the endpoint. Payloads are replayed verbatim with a new delivery ID. After final failure, events sit in the dead-letter queue for 14 days and can be replayed manually. For release cutover questions or queue drains, contact the delivery team owner below.

alerts address for bajop-yahog: istwyn@lumiclabs.internal

# Break-Glass: Marlowe Transcode Farm

If the Grayvale scheduler is down and normal auth fails, use break-glass. Scope: restart stuck transcode workers only. Log every action in the incident channel. Access expires after 60 minutes. At the console prompt on the farm bastion, supply the break-glass recovery passphrase listed immediately below.

unlock words, tawif-tahop: oliys-ulawyn-tamdor-lamys-casox-jormir-fraius-kasath-ulador-ulamir-holir-sorys-holeth